1. A switchable communicator, comprising:

  • a processor for running at least one communication service, up to at least communication layer 2, in conjunction with a computer to which the communicator is docked;

    a memory coupled with said processor for storing program code and data for the at least one communication service;

    a modem coupled with said processor for transmitting and receiving data for the at least one communication service;

    an input device coupled with said processor for inputting data to be transmitted by the at least one communication service;

    an output device coupled with said processor for displaying data that is received by the at least one communication service; and

    an interface for docking the communicator to the computer, and for synchronizing communication service data between the communicator and the computer when the communicator is docked to the computer, wherein the computer may be in an active mode or in an inactive mode, and wherein said processor switches to run the at least one communication service by itself, up to communication layer 7, when the computer is in inactive mode.
